ἄνωγα , perf. w. pres.
meaning, imp. ἄνωχθι, -ώχθω and -ωγείτω, -ωχθε and -ώχετε, inf. -ωγέμεν, plup.
ἠνώγεα, ἠνώγει and -ειν, ἀνώγει (also forms that may be referred
to ἀνώγω as pres. and ipf.), ἀνώγει, -ετον, subj. ἀνώγῃ, opt. ἀνώγοιμι, ipf.
ἤνωγον, ἄνωγον, fut. ἀνώξω, aor. ἤνωξα: bid, command; foll. by acc. and
inf., ἄνωχθι δέ μιν γαμέεσθαι, Od. 2.113; very seldom w. dat. of person,
δέμνἰ ἄνωγεν ὑποστορέσαι
δμωῇσιν, Od. 20.139; freq.
joined with ἐπο-
τρυ?νω, κέλομαι, and esp. w. θυ_μός, (two accusatives) τά με θυ_μὸς ἀνώγει, Il.
19.102.
